A sad fact but I know nothing about cars, I haven't owned one of my own for 15 years, and the wife has the family motor which is always newish and I've never had to lift a bonnet other than to top up the screen wash. But my old boy is ill and practicality dictates I need car. The vehicle will need to essentially do about 50 miles of a and b road driving each day, and would very rarely need to touch a motorway. It won't need to carry much.

We are down to 2 favourites which are both priced a bit under 2 grand.

1 - y reg ford focus 1.8 zetec, 34,000 miles on it, FSH with yearly services.
2 - 04 Fiat punto 1.2 dynamic 80, 43,000 miles 6 services and had it's engine management thing sorted about 20,000 miles ago.

Both drive fine, no knocking, or pulling, clutch feels fine etc, and both look OK.

Which would you go for?
